Silver denarius of Pertinax (AD 193) (Reece Period 10), VOT DECEN TR P COS II, Emperor, veiled, standing left, sacrificing with patera over tripod. Mint of Rome. RIC IV, pt 1, p. 8, no. 13a.
Pertinax only ruled for three months and his coins are subsequently rare. There are fifteen coins for him on the PAS Database with ten denarii from England. This is the second example of this coin recorded - see BERK-DF2625.
